In military aviation, area bombardment (or area bombing) is a type of aerial bombardment in which bombs are dropped over the general area of a target. The term "area bombing" came into prominence during World War II. Area bombing is a form of strategic bombing. WebDer erste Angriff, der nach der Area Bombing Directive durchgeführt wurde, war der Luftangriff auf Lübeck am 29.März 1942.Ihm folgten Luftangriffe auf das Ruhrgebiet und im Mai 1942 der erste sogenannte „Tausend-Bomber-Angriff“ auf Köln (Operation Millennium). WebThe Hiroshima Peace Memorial (Genbaku Dome) was the only structure left standing in the area where the first atomic bomb exploded on 6 August 1945. Through the efforts of many people, including those of the city of Hiroshima, it has been preserved in the same state as immediately after the bombing.
